Unified Falcons National Recognitions

Congratulations Unified Falcons! Charles P. Murray Middle School has been awarded recognition as a Class of 2021 Unified Champion National Banner Schools by Special Olympics. Only 68 schools in the nation were given this honor and are considered national models of inclusion.

Special Olympics defines a Unified Champion School as a school that demonstrates a commitment to inclusion and commits to these activities:

  • Special Olympics Unified Sports® where students with and without disabilities train and compete as teammates
  • Inclusive Youth Leadership
  • and Whole-School Engagement.

Each year, Special Olympics honor schools that go above and beyond to:

  • Choose to include all members of the school community
  • Show respect to all members of the school community
  • Commit to spreading inclusion in their community

These schools that serve as national models of inclusion are awarded status as a Unified Champion National Banner School. Only five of these schools are in North Carolina. These schools are Idlewild Elementary, Green Hope High School, Francis Bradley Middle School, Duke University, and Charles P. Murray Middle School.
